Aging Air Force Satellites Could Send GPSs Incomplete Directions and Decrease Accuracy of Strikes

Well, did you all know that satellite systems are also aging and could potentially provide incorrect data and directions to GPS systems? According to a recent GAO study, the Global Positioning System that provides personal navigation in private cars, as well as data for military strikes, could start to falter as early as next year.
